Given that y is inversely as x+3 and that y=4 when x =2 (a)express y in terms of x (b)find the value of y when x =5 .

a. Expressing y in terms of x, y = 20/(x + 3)

b. When x = 5, the value of y is 2.5

The question has to do with inverse variation.

<h3>What is inverse variation?</h3>

Inverse variation is variation in which one quantity varies inversely as the other.

<h3>a. How to express y in terms of x?</h3>

Given that y is inversely as x + 3 and that y = 4 when x = 2.

Since y varies inversely as x + 3, we have

y ∝ 1/(x + 3)

y = k/(x + 3)

When y = 4, x = 3. So

y = k/(x + 3)

4 = k/(2 + 3)

4 = k/5

k = 4 × 5

k = 20

So, y = k/(x + 3)

y = 20/(x + 3)

So, expressing y in terms of x, y = 20/(x + 3)

<h3>b. Find the value of y when x = 5.</h3>

Since  y = 20/(x + 3)

Substituting x = 5 into the equation, we have

y = 20/(x + 3)

y = 20/(5 + 3)

y = 20/8

y = 5/2

y = 2.5

So, when x = 5, the value of y is 2.5

Factor as the product of two binomials.<br> X^2 – 10x + 21
kondaur [170]
You can use the butterfly method. Two numbers that equal A times C must also add up to B. A=1 B=-10 C=21. A times C is 21 and B is -10. Two numbers that multiply to 21 and add to -10 are -7 and -3. Factored form: ( x - 7 )( x - 3 ).

Solve for y.<br> r/3-2/y=s/5
nordsb [41]

Answer:

y = 2 / (r/3 - s/5)

Step-by-step explanation:

r/3 - 2/y = s/5

add 2/y to both sides

r/3 = s/5 + 2/y

Subtract s/5 from both sides

r/3 - s/5 = 2/y

multiply both sides by y

y(r/3 - s/5) = 2

Divide both sides by r/3 - s/5

y = 2 / (r/3 - s/5)
